#973423 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#973423 is composed of 59.2% red, 20.4%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.6% magenta, 76.8%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 8.8 degrees, a saturation of 62.4% and a lightness of 36.5%. #973423 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6846 with #2f0000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

● #973423 color description : Dark red.
The hexadecimal color #973423 has RGB values of R:151, G:52,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.77,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9909283.
